Evenings for the Engaged

Evenings for the Engaged is sponsored by the parish. It is series of seven sessions usually presented by a team consisting of dedicated, Catholic married couples and a priest or deacon. The purpose is to explain the joys, problems, wonders and satisfactions of marriage as a sacramental covenant between each other and Jesus Christ. Each meeting is held at the home of a married couple in the parish. This program is the norm for marriage preparation at Light of Christ.

Marriage Encounter

Weekend designed for married couples to make a good marriage great. The emphasis is on communication between husband and wife, who spend a weekend together away from the distractions and the tensions of everyday life, to concentrate on each other. It is a unique approach aimed at revitalizing Christian marriage.

Marriage Preparation
Program

This program helps to prepare the engaged couple spiritually for the sacrament of matrimony. The couple should also prepare for the financial and worldly encounters of their marriage vocation. Diocesan guidelines require a six-month notice period, which gives the priest and the Parish Engagement Ministry Team ample preparation time for completion of forms, and the engaged couple time to attend required parish and diocesan programs.

RCIA Inquiry

The Rite of Christian Initiation for Adults (RCIA) is a comprehensive catechetical process.  The classes are designed to bring people interested in joining the Catholic faith into a full knowledge of the church and the Sacraments of Initiation.  Classes are also designed for Catholics who desire to deepen their Faith Journey

RCIA Sponsors

RCIA Sponsors are companions and guides to those folks who are seeking to learn about the Catholic faith and think they want to be fully initiated into the Catholic Church.  A Sponsor�s witness and friendship helps the seeker to find a home here.  The Sponsor represents the Church to the seeker and the seeker to the Church.
